Output 25ed145bfeac53f084c7df1c59f66f41770463d147d3008dc2dcd0c227dc07da:21

value
11666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44e866a627092dbf87b94edd08f6ff20de68e53816038a9a26a731eabd88272c
address
bc1pgn5xdf38pykmlpaefmws3ahlyr0x3efczcpc4x3x5uc740vgyukqcvqzkc
transaction
25ed145bfeac53f084c7df1c59f66f41770463d147d3008dc2dcd0c227dc07da
confirmations
106625
spent
true